‘We’re just so proud’: Illini welcomed home by hundreds after punching Final Four ticket

The Final Four is on Saturday, April 4th inside Lucas Oil Stadium. Photo: Contributed


Champaign, IL (WAND) – Celebrations continued Sunday as the Fighting Illini men’s basketball team returned home from their Elite Eight win over Iowa.

The Illini came out of the plane to a sea of orange and blue, as hundreds of fans packed Willard Airport to cheer them on.

“We’re just so proud of these guys. They have fought hard,” said Illini fan Sharon Grogan. “We watched all season. They’ve done it all. So, we’re here to just let them know how much we love them and support them.”

Fans had everything from signs and flags, to celebratory dances, as they waited for the team to land. For longtime fans, the return to the Final Four brought back memories of Illinois’ unforgettable national champion runner-up team in 2005.

Now, Illini nation is rallying behind its team as they prepare for college basketball’s biggest stage. The Final Four is on Saturday, April 4th inside Lucas Oil Stadium.
